Christie Torruella Smith named vice president for Enrollment Management at Alfred University

Beth Ann Dobie, Alfred University provost and chief operating officer, announces the appointment of Christie Torruella Smith as the university’s new vice president for Enrollment Management. Smith will begin her duties Jan. 20, 2026.

Alfred Ceramic Art Museum announces the Betty Woodman Collection at Alfred University

The Alfred Ceramic Art Museum is pleased to announce the establishment of the Betty Woodman Collection at Alfred University, a gift of 29 objects and works on paper representing Woodman’s oeuvre.

Mechanical engineering faculty Mehdi Kabir, students attend IMECE Conference

A senior design team of mechanical engineering students from Alfred University, led and advised by Mehdi Kabir, assistant professor of mechanical engineering, delivered an oral presentation of their research at the International Mechanical Engineering Congress & Exposition (IMECE), held Nov. 16-20 in Memphis, TN.
